How they compare

Cuba currently reports 344,149 against 324,717 in Sweden, a difference of 19,432.

That makes Cuba's figure about 1.1 times Sweden's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Cuba ahead.

Cuba ranks 95th and Sweden ranks 96th of 217 countries.

Cuba has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cuba Sweden Difference Ahead
1960s 304,713 245,886 58,827 Cuba
1970s 349,599 330,622 18,977 Cuba
1980s 413,777 291,360 122,417 Cuba
1990s 575,434 317,547 257,887 Cuba
2000s 405,795 287,301 118,495 Cuba
2010s 402,530 338,410 64,120 Cuba
2020s 350,462 346,210 4,252 Cuba

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
